Summary

House Bill 0974, titled 'PUBLIC EMPLOYEE BENEFITS-TECH', seeks to amend the Illinois Pension Code, specifically by making technical changes in a section that concerns definitions. The bill aims to provide clarity and ensure that the terminology used within the Pension Code is accurately defined and standardized. While the bill does not propose any substantive changes to the existing pension benefits, it plays a crucial role in maintaining the integrity of how these terms are interpreted in the law regarding public employee benefits.
